Retirement Party Attire
Dress Code
When it comes to retirement party attire, the dress code can vary depending on the type of party and the venue. It’s important to take into consideration the invitation and any specific instructions or requests from the host. Some retirement parties may be more casual, while others may require formal attire.
What to Wear?
Consider wearing a nice pair of jeans or slacks with a dress shirt or blouse for a casual retirement party.
For semi-formal events, a cocktail dress or dressy suit is appropriate. Formal events may require a black-tie dress code, where a tuxedo or formal gown is expected.
Accessories
Accessories can add a touch of personality to your retirement party outfit. Consider adding a statement necklace or earrings to dress up a simple outfit. For men, a stylish watch or cufflinks can add a touch of sophistication.
Colors
When choosing what to wear to a retirement party, consider the colors you wear. Neutral colors such as black, gray, and navy are always a safe choice. However, don’t be afraid to add a pop of color to your outfit with a bright accessory or print.

Shoes
Shoes can make or break an outfit, so choosing the right pair for the occasion is important. When it comes to a retirement party, comfort is key. You’ll likely be on your feet for a while, so opt for shoes you can wear for an extended period.
Flat Sandals
Flat sandals are a great option for a retirement party, especially if held outdoors or in a more casual setting. They’re comfortable and stylish and come in a wide variety of colors and styles. Be sure to choose a pair that complements your outfit and fits comfortably.
Sneakers
Sneakers are another option for a retirement party, particularly if you’re going for a more casual look. They’re comfortable and practical and can be dressed up or down depending on the rest of your outfit. Choose a clean, stylish pair that won’t clash with your outfit.
Jewelry is an essential accessory for any retirement party outfit. It adds a touch of elegance and sophistication to your look. Here are a few tips to help you choose the right jewelry for your retirement party outfit:
Keep it simple: Avoid wearing too much jewelry. Choose one or two statement pieces that complement your outfit. For example, a pair of diamond studs or a simple pendant necklace can add a touch of glamour to your look.
Match your metals: If you’re wearing gold, stick to gold jewelry, and if you’re wearing silver, stick to silver jewelry. Mixing metals can look tacky and clash with your outfit.
Consider the neckline: The neckline of your outfit should dictate the type of jewelry you wear. If you’re wearing a high neckline, opt for a statement necklace that sits above the neckline. If you’re wearing a low neckline, choose a pendant necklace or a pair of statement earrings.
Don’t forget your wrists: Bracelets can add a touch of elegance to your outfit. Choose a simple bangle or a statement cuff to complement your outfit.
Avoid oversized jewelry: Oversized jewelry can overwhelm your outfit and make you look gaudy. Stick to simple, elegant pieces that complement your outfit.
The key to choosing the right jewelry for your retirement party outfit is to keep it simple and elegant. Stick to one or two statement pieces that complement your outfit, and avoid wearing too much jewelry.

Retirement Party Planning
Planning a retirement party can be daunting, but with some preparation and attention to detail, you can create a memorable celebration for the retiree.
Once you have a date and venue in mind, it’s time to send out invitations. Ensure to include all the important details, such as the date, time, location, and dress code. You may also want to include information about any gifts or contributions that guests can bring to the party.
Consider sending out invitations via email or an online invitation service to make RSVPs easier to manage.
Venue
Choosing the right venue is key to a successful retirement party. Consider the size of the guest list, the retiree’s preferences, and the overall vibe you want to create. If you’re hosting the party at home, make sure to plan for enough seating, food, and drinks.
If you’re renting a space, make sure to book well in advance and confirm all the details with the venue beforehand.
Speech
A retirement party wouldn’t be complete without a heartfelt speech. If you’re the host, consider saying a few words about the retiree’s accomplishments and contributions to the workplace. You may also want to invite colleagues, friends, or family members to share their own memories and well wishes.
Make sure to keep the speech positive and uplifting, and avoid any negative or controversial topics.

Q. What is the appropriate attire for a retirement party?
The appropriate attire for a retirement party depends on the formality of the event. If the party is casual, you can wear business casual attire such as slacks and a collared shirt. For a more formal event, a suit or dress is appropriate. Checking with the host or hostess for specific dress code instructions is always best.
Q. Can I wear jeans to a retirement party?
Jeans can be appropriate for a casual retirement party, but avoiding them for a more formal event is best. If you wear jeans, ensure they are clean and in good condition, and pair them with a nice shirt or blouse. Avoid ripped or overly casual jeans.
Q. What colors should I avoid wearing to a retirement party?
It’s best to avoid wearing white, as this color is typically reserved for the retiree. Additionally, avoid wearing anything too flashy or attention-grabbing, as the focus of the party should be on the retiree. Avoiding wearing anything too vibrant or provocative is also a good idea.
Q. Can I wear sandals to a retirement party?
Sandals can be appropriate for a casual retirement party, but avoiding them for a more formal event is best. If you wear sandals, ensure they are clean and in good condition, and avoid overly casual styles such as flip-flops. Closed-toe shoes are always a safe choice for a retirement party.
Q. What accessories should I wear to a retirement party?
Accessories should be kept simple and understated. A nice watch, a piece of jewelry, or a scarf can be a nice touch, but avoid anything too flashy or distracting. It’s also important to make sure your accessories don’t clash with your outfit or the overall tone of the event.
